自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(248)
  • 收藏
  • 关注

原创 CentOS常用命令

[安装epel源]centos7:#rpm -Uvh https://dl.fedoraproject.org/pub/epel/7/x86_64/Packages/e/epel-release-7-11.noarch.rpmcentos6:#rpm -Uvhhttps://dl.fedoraproject.org/pub/epel/6/x86_64/epel-release-...

2017-06-06 12:29:15 663

原创 Floccus实现跨浏览器书签同步

Floccus实现跨浏览器同步书签

2024-01-26 14:23:28 963

原创 Docker部署禅道

docker部署zentaodocker-compose部署zentaozentao 外部mysql

2023-12-26 14:31:06 401

原创 基于Alpine 制作JDK8镜像并支持中文

基于Alpine 制作JDK8镜像并支持中文

2023-07-17 15:49:43 680

原创 Nginx四层负载+反向代理

Nginx四层负载均衡配置, Nginx反向代理配置

2023-03-19 13:29:22 423 1

原创 MYSQL8.0绿色版部署

mysql 8.0绿色版部署

2023-01-03 16:11:36 340

原创 skywalking使用kafka传输数据

skywalking使用kafka传输数据

2022-12-29 10:42:18 3860

原创 Dockerfile构建oracle-jdk镜像-解决中文乱码问题

Dockerfile制作oracle-jdk镜像, 解决中文乱码

2022-12-28 09:44:32 516

原创 Dockerfile构建openresty-vts镜像

Dockerfile构建openresty-vts镜像

2022-12-28 09:40:59 315

原创 普通用户启动docker

普通用户启动docker

2022-09-01 14:27:24 1194

原创 修复SSH服务支持弱加密算法漏洞

老版本ssh服务支持弱加密算法漏洞

2022-07-06 09:51:02 1881

原创 部署Weblogic10.3.6

weblogic10.3.6部署

2022-06-22 10:01:30 1638

原创 FreeIPA配置笔记

FreeIPA部署, Gitlab集成FreeIPA, Jenkins集成FreeIPA, Jumpserver集成FreeIPA, Jira集成FreeIPA

2022-06-16 15:58:09 1239

原创 ELK过滤Nginx日志和Java日志

日志样例JAVA固定格式[2022-05-30T14:54:07.579+08:00] [INFO] [,] [cn.git.workflow.util.WorkFlowFactory] [ccms-test-17] [3.1.101.55] [workflow-server] [WorkFlowFactory.java,163,cn.git.workflow.util.WorkFlowFactory,getWebServiceProperties] [webService获取地址类型serviceT

2022-05-30 15:35:44 283

原创 Nginx跨域配置

server { listen 80; # 监听的端⼝ server_name localhost; # 域名或ip location / { # 访问路径配置 #允许跨域请求的域,* 代表所有 add_header 'Access-Control-Allow-Origin' *; #允许带上cookie请求 add_header 'Access-Control-Allow-Credentials' 'true'; #允许请求的方法,比如 GET/POST/PUT/DELETE

2022-05-24 16:57:03 3139

原创 shell脚本字体设置

#!/bin/bash# 字体及颜色Green="\033[32m"Red="\033[31m"Yellow="\033[33m"GreenBG="\033[42;37m"RedBG="\033[41;37m"Font="\033[0m"#notification informationInfo="${Green}[信息]${Font}"Warning="${Yellow}[警告]${Font}"OK="${Green}[OK]${Font}"Error="${Red}[错误]$

2022-05-17 15:34:56 864

原创 Dockerfile构建openresty-vts镜像

下载地址openrestynginx-module-vtsnginx-module-stream-stsnginx-module-sts模块下载zip格式的, tar包有一个无法解压目录结构tree.├── Dockerfile├── nginx.conf├── nginx-module-stream-sts-0.1.1.zip├── nginx-module-sts-0.1.1.zip├── nginx-module-vts-0.1.18.zip├── openresty-

2022-04-26 15:51:42 811

原创 Openresty集成prometheus_lua和skywalking_lua笔记

Github文档skywalking-nginx-luanginx-lua-prometheusOpenresty部署-Docker方式创建目录mkdir -pv /data/openresty/lua_libmkdir -pv /data/openresty/nginx/{logs/vhosts/upstream}下载对应lua文件到/data/openresty/lua_lib目录, 结构如下tree.├── nginx-lua-prometheus│ ├── promet

2022-04-25 13:41:19 3569

原创 systemd服务详解

模块概述[Unit]部分主要是对这个服务的说明,内容, 文档介绍以及对一些依赖服务定义Description:描述信息After:表明需要依赖的服务,作用决定启动顺序Before:表明被依赖的服务Requles:依赖到的其他unit ,强依赖,即依赖的unit启动失败。该unit不启动。Wants:依赖到的其他unit,弱依赖,即依赖的unit 启动失败。该unit继续启动Conflicts:定义冲突关系处理依赖关系使用systemd时,可通过正确编写单元配置文件来解决其依赖关系。典

2021-12-24 16:21:05 3515

原创 CentOS 7部署OpenStack-Train

前置条件系统和版本CentOS版本和OpenStack版本对应关系, 参考阿里云镜像站CentOS 7 - https://mirrors.aliyun.com/centos/7/cloud/x86_64/ - 支持到Train版本 CentOS 8 - https://mirrors.aliyun.com/centos/8/cloud/x86_64/ - 支持版本, 从Train版本到Victoria版本系统环境要求1. 卸载firewall服务2. 卸载Network

2021-12-08 10:49:36 3419

原创 CentOS 8部署OpenStack-Victoria版本

前置条件系统和版本CentOS版本和OpenStack版本对应关系, 参考阿里云镜像站CentOS 7 - https://mirrors.aliyun.com/centos/7/cloud/x86_64/ - 支持到Train版本 CentOS 8 - https://mirrors.aliyun.com/centos/8/cloud/x86_64/ - 支持版本, 从Train版本到Victoria版本系统环境要求1. 卸载firewall服务2. 卸载Network

2021-12-07 10:33:00 1579

原创 Hive3.X高可用部署

一、部署规划hadoop高可用集群部署参考: Hadoop3.X分布式高可用集群部署1.1 版本说明软件版本操作系统CentOS Linux release 7.8.2003 (Core)JAVAjdk-8u271-linux-x64Hadoophadoop-3.2.2Hivehive-3.1.21.2 集群规划hive远程模式 && hiveserver2高可用hostnameIP组件maste

2021-10-04 21:39:25 2141 2

原创 Hbase2.3.X高可用部署

一、部署规划hadoop高可用集群部署参考: Hadoop3.X分布式高可用集群部署1.1 版本说明软件版本操作系统CentOS Linux release 7.8.2003 (Core)JAVAjdk-8u271-linux-x64Hadoophadoop-3.2.2Hbasehbase-2.3.61.2 集群规划hostnameIP组件master172.16.20.200NameNodeHbase-H

2021-10-04 21:34:04 224

原创 Spark3.X分布式集群部署

一、部署规划hadoop高可用集群部署参考: Hadoop3.X分布式高可用集群部署1.1 版本说明软件版本操作系统CentOS Linux release 7.8.2003 (Core)JAVAjdk-8u271-linux-x64Hadoophadoop-3.3.1ScalaScala2.12.15Sparkspark-3.1.2-bin-hadoop3.21.2 集群规划hostnameIP组件maste

2021-09-28 14:22:25 765

原创 Hadoop3.X分布式高可用集群部署

一、部署规划1.1 版本说明软件版本操作系统CentOS Linux release 7.8.2003 (Core)hadoophadoop-3.3.1JAVAjdk-8u271-linux-x641.2 集群规划hostnameIP组件master172.16.20.200NameNodeZKFailoverControllersecondmaster172.16.20.201NameNode

2021-09-28 09:50:57 960

原创 二进制方式安装Docker

解压部署下载地址https://download.docker.com/linux/static/stable/x86_64/tar zxf docker-20.10.8.tgzmv docker/* /usr/bin/编辑docker配置文件mkdir /etc/dockercat > /etc/docker/daemon.json << EOF{"registry-mirrors": ["https://gsm39obv.mirror.aliyuncs.com"],

2021-09-17 16:34:16 494

原创 Prometheus常用告警规则

Prometheus.rulescat > /data/prometheus/conf/rules/Prometheus.yaml << 'EOF'groups:- name: Prometheus.rules rules: - alert: PrometheusTargetMissing expr: up == 0 for: 0m labels: severity: critical annotations: summ

2021-09-16 09:09:26 6217 4

原创 部署Kubernetes高可用集群(v1.22,二进制)

一. 系统软件环境软件版本操作系统CentOS Linux release 7.8.2003 (Core)Dockerdocker-20.10.8-ceKubernetes1.22.1ETCDetcd-v3.5.0节点组件角色IP组件k8s-master172.16.20.50kube-apiserver, kube-controller-manager, kube-scheduler, docker, kubelet, ku

2021-09-06 13:16:26 4559 2

原创 skywalking集群部署+动态配置发布

集群配置说明集群模式- 基于nacos动态配置发布- 基于nacos存储- 基于elasticsearch7nacos配置参照nacos部署es配置参照ELK部署创建配置目录mkdir -pv /data/skywalking/{config,data}加载配置文件方式部署docker-compose编排mkdir -pv /data/docker-compose/skywalkingcat > /data/docker-compose/skywalking/docker-

2021-07-28 16:55:28 3736

原创 Grafana展示ES中nginx日志

Filebeat->kafka->logstash->ES->GrafanaELK集群部署参照: ELK集群部署kafka集群部署参照: kafka集群部署Nginx日志配置修改nginx日志格式,并重启nginx log_format json '{"@timestamp":"$time_iso8601",' '"host":"$hostname",' '"server_ip":"$server_addr",'

2021-07-22 16:18:39 1374 1

原创 Docker部署nextcloud

创建数据目录mkdir -pv /data/nextcloud/db/postgreDatamkdir -pv /data/nextcloud/app/wwwrootdocker-compose编排mkdir -pv /data/docker-compose/nextcloudcat > /data/docker-compose/nextcloud/docker-compose.yml << EOFversion: "3"services: db: contai

2021-07-18 15:25:49 322

原创 Docker部署LDAP自助密码服务self-service-password

公网环境使用现成的docker镜像创建数据目录mkdir -pv /data/openldap/self-service-password/{htdocs,logs}mkdir /data/docker-compose/openldap/ssp/docker-compose文件cat > /data/docker-compose/openldap/ssp/docker-compose.yml << EOFversion: "3"services: self-ser

2021-06-20 14:29:03 3076

原创 Docker部署OpenLDAP

LDAP说明什么是LDAP?轻型目录访问协议(Lightweight Directory Access Protocol,LDAP):是一个开放的、中立的、业标准的应用协议,通过IP协议提供访问控制和维护分布式信息的目录信息,它是由目录数据库和一套访问协议组成的系统,详情请查看维基百科LDAP。为什么用LDAP?LDAP是开放的Internet标准,市场上或者开源社区的绝大多数软件都支持LDAP协议。简单来说,LDAP协议最大的好处就是能统一管理用户密码,新人报道创建一个用户就能登录公司的所有平台

2021-06-20 14:25:43 2242 2

原创 Jira集成GitLab

配置步骤在Jira中添加gitlab专属用户此用户在项目中至少要具备以下三种权限添加注释创建问题链接工作流转换GitLab中集成jira配置网络Admin Area --> Setting --> Network --> 展开Outbound requests勾选Allow requests to the local network from web hooks and services否则添加jira时候报如下错误:Validations failed. Url

2021-06-08 14:07:17 1115

原创 Docker部署Gitlab代码仓库

创建数据目录mkdir -pv /data/gitlab/{data,config,logs}mkdir -pv /data/docker-compose/gitlab/配置docker-compose文件cat > /data/docker-compose/gitlab/docker-compose.yml << EOFversion: "3"services: gitlab: container_name: gitlab image: gitlab/g

2021-06-07 16:55:44 206

原创 部署Jira & Confluence基于postgre数据库

服务规划服务名称数据目录访问端口/数据端口客户端访问地址Postgre/data/atlassian/postgre/postgreData254323.1.101.36:25432Jira/data/atlassian/jira80803.1.101.36:8080Confluence/data/atlassian/confluence8090/80913.1.101.36:8090基础环境配置创建应用数据目录mkdir -pv /data

2021-06-03 13:34:29 1083

原创 Docker部署Jira & Confluence--基于Mysql数据库

服务规划服务名称数据目录访问端口/数据端口客户端访问地址mysql/data/atlassian/mysql83063.1.101.36:8306jira/data/atlassian/jira80803.1.101.36:8080confluence/data/atlassian/confluence8090/80913.1.101.36:8090基础环境配置创建应用数据目录mkdir -pv /data/atlassian/mys

2021-05-29 11:25:41 2698 2

原创 kubernetes v1.20.6部署kube-prometheus

下载github地址https://github.com/prometheus-operator/kube-prometheuswget https://github.com/prometheus-operator/kube-prometheus/archive/refs/tags/v0.8.0.tar.gztar -zxf kube-prometheus-0.8.0.tar.gzcd kube-prometheus-0.8.0/manifests所有配置均在manifests下配置持

2021-05-21 16:24:03 907 1

原创 K8S挂载ceph

动态供给(StorageClass)-RBD方式Ceph配置1. kubelet节点安装rbd命令,将ceph的ceph.client.admin.keyring和ceph.conf文件拷贝到master的/etc/ceph目录下yum -y install ceph-common2. 创建 osd pool 在ceph的mon或者admin节点ceph osd pool create kube-data 128 128ceph osd pool ls3. 创建k8s访问ceph的用户,

2021-05-20 16:35:07 798

原创 部署Ceph分布式存储

一、环境准备1. 关闭防火墙systemctl stop firewalldsystemctl disable firewalld2. 关闭selinuxsetenforce 03. 关闭NetworkManagersystemctl stop NetworkManagersystemctl disable NetworkManager4. 配置hostscat >> /etc/hosts << 'EOF'## Ceph Node192.168.2.10

2021-05-20 16:33:35 1528

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除